Softball Survives Wild Comeback, Splits Saturday at Loyola Chicago
5/3/2025 8:30:00 PM | Softball
CHICAGO - The George Washington University softball team split the two games of Saturday's doubleheader at Loyola Chicago. GW came from behind to win a turbulent game one before being edged out by a late home run in game two. The Revolutionaries move to 31-19, which includes a 15-10 record in the A-10 with one game remaining in the regular season.
GW 10, Loyola Chicago 9
A sixth-inning Daniella Lew two-RBI double put GW ahead for good in a wild back-and-forth affair in game one that saw a total of 19 runs, 23 hits and six errors between the Revolutionaries and Ramblers.
GW scored one with the bases loaded in the first, but fell behind quickly as Loyola Chicago mounted a 6-1 lead by the end of the second inning. In the absence of offensive leader Ashley Corpuz, Emi Todoroki and Lew stepped up with seven combined RBI, which included four RBI for Todoroki and her first career home run - a three-run no-doubter in the third to bring GW back within two runs.
In the fourth, the Ramblers pushed the lead back up to three to make it 7-4, but GW recaptured the momentum by tying the game with a three-run fifth that started with a Todoroki sac fly and ended with a Lew RBI double.
Just as GW had leveled the action, the Ramblers snatched the lead right back with two scores in the bottom of the fifth. The deficit would have been more, had Allison Heffley - playing in left field - not gunned down a runner with a perfect throw to home.
GW kept its foot on the gas in the sixth, cutting the lead back to one on a Carolyn Skotz RBI single, before Lew delivered the game-winning hit with a two run double which put GW in the driver's seat to the finish.
Chloe Greene wrapped the wild contest with a zero-run, two-inning save. Sophia Torreso picked up the win after throwing 4.0 innings and keeping GW in the contest in the middle innings.
Five Revolutionaries finished with two-hit games (Gilliland, Layfield, Mays. Todoroki, Lew), while Heffley and Madie Hernendez drew two walks apiece.
GW 2, Loyola Chicago 3
Looking to clinch the series in game two of the doubleheader, GW needed another come-from-behind victory after falling behind early. However, in the bottom of the fifth and just after the visitors evened the score at 2-2, Loyola Chicago's Haley Wallace blasted a solo home to take a 3-2 lead which the Ramblers held to the finish.
It was Anna Reed GW and Andie Broniewicz for Loyola Chicago starting in game two in the circle. Both were tagged with two runs and had limited strikeout numbers as both teams were putting the ball in play. Chloe Greene again pitched the final 2.0 innings for GW - the solo home run off Greene was her only blemish over 4.0 innings across the doubleheader.
The Ramblers' leadoff batter Riley Owens reached safely and scored in both of her at-bats in both the first and third innings to give Loyola Chicago its 2-0 lead. In the fifth, Layfield nabbed GW's only RBI on a single through the right side, before Madi Mays reached on a fielding error by the Ramblers' shortstop to score Gilliland.Â
Both teams finished with six hits, two walks and one error.
